What is good about Tesla cars? What about their quality? A summary of pros and cons of Tesla cars.

Tesla has always been a pioneer in the field of electric cars in the last decade. When people decide to switch from gas-powered vehicles to electric vehicles with a budget around 30.000 to 50.000 dollars, their first consideration is Tesla. So what exactly is good about Tesla cars? And what are the drawbacks? 

Pros of Tesla cars

  1. Excellent battery management system
    Tesla’s battery management system (BMS) has always been a cutting edge technology that other manufacturers are trying to catch up with. Tesla has a total of 3304 patents globally, and a big portion of them are for the battery management system, cooling, safety, etc. Which can guarantee the safety of the battery during the use of the vehicle, and to slow down capacity loss as much as possible.
  2. High brand recognition
    Since Tesla was one of the best brands advocating for electric mobility, it has always been the brand associated with electric mobility in the eyes of most customers. It is not an exaggeration to say that it is a brand that is well-known to adults as well as children, even in the eyes of some people who do not know much about cars, which gives the brand the feel it is not ordinary.
  3. High Residual Value
    Tesla cars usually have a high resale value. For example Tesla Model Y has the highest residual value among EVs. Typically in four years of ownership, the car retains 64% of its original value, which is the best among all electric cars. On the EV market there are a lot of cars with a lot of differences, which is very important as consumers can find a vehicle that fits their needs and budget. However, one of the important indicators for customers when buying a new car is the residual value, which makes Tesla cars one of the best choices.
  4. High degree of intelligence
    Tesla cars interior design
    Tesla interior

    The software of all Tesla Models support OTA upgrades, so there will be no backwardness in the car and its computer system. Secondly, all Tesla models have canceled most of the physical buttons used to adjust the cabin heating, air conditioning, headlights, etc in the car and integrated many features into the touchscreen, and almost all functions support intelligent voice control.
    In addition, Tesla’s autonomous driving assistance system is a cutting edge technology in the automotive industry. The car collects continuous data to strengthen its own algorithm and provide the user with a better driving experience.


Of course, Tesla is not all good. Actually there are many drawbacks to consider when trying to buy a Tesla.

Cons of Tesla cars

  1. Limited Color Options and esthetics
    The visual appeal of your vehicle may resemble that of many others, as Teslas are increasingly prevalent on today’s roads. When acquiring a Tesla, you are limited to a standard choice of approximately four colors, with only a few potential upgrades available.
  2. Long waiting time
    Nowadays, when ordering a car through Tesla’s official website, the best-selling Model Y is expected to take at least 3 months to be delivered, and Model 3 needs to wait for more than 4-5 months to complete delivery, not to mention Model X and Model S.
  3. High maintenance costs
    Except for the Model 3, Tesla’s other models all use aluminum alloy integrated forged bodies, and the Model 3’s body uses a large amount of high-strength steel and aluminum mixed metals, which directly leads to very expensive maintenance costs for Tesla models.
  4. Many negative reports
    When it comes to Tesla cars, the first thing many people think of is “brake failure”. In recent years, Tesla has been exposed to suspected brake failures, leading many people to think that this car is not safe at all.

Overall the advantages of owning a Tesla are far greater than the disadvantages and we extremely recommend Tesla cars for new EV adopters.
